Maceo Plex & Maars – Going Back (Original Mix) [Preview]
Despite a hectic Balearic and festival touring schedule this summer, Maceo Plex has still found the time to tease with good tunes. "Going Back" is as sexy as any Ellum release, with brimming bass lines and downbeat drums, Maceo creates an aural environment well-tuned to Maars's haunting vocal work. Although Maceo sneaked this record into his debut March Boiler Room set a few months back, there's still no word on a official release from Ellum Audio.

Crayon feat. KLP – Give You Up (Yuksek Dub Mix) [Free Download]
Rolling Stone is giving away the French producer/DJ Yuksek's Dub Mix of Lauren Crayon (or just Crayon for short)'s "Give You Up" with KLP on vocals. Crayon explains that this version was actually the "playback version" KLP and Yuksek played live together at a recent show in Sydney, and he got to listen to his own song being played "on the other side of the world." Initial lineup for inaugural US Sensation tour includes Fedde Le Grand, Nic Fanciulli, Sébastien Léger, Michael Woods, and more
ID&T has announced its initial lineup for this year's first-ever US Sensation tour. The tour this year is making stops in the San Francisco Bay Area, Las Vegas, and Miami before returning back to Barclays Center in Brooklyn for the second time. There'll be more to come, but the first DJs confirmed for this tour include the veteran Sensation-er Fedde Le Grand, Nic Fanciulli, Sébastien Léger, Michael Woods, Prok & Fitch, Sunnery James & Ryan Marciano, and of course the Sensation residents Mr. White and McGee. Nile Rodgers and Chic to replace D’Angelo at San Francisco’s Outside Lands this weekend
According to SF Weekly, D'Angelo just announced he will be unable to make his Friday performance at this year's Outside Lands in San Francisco's Golden Gate Park. The cancellation reportedly stems from a "medical emergency." Luckily, there is a very satisfactory replacement set to perform in lieu of the crooner's 6:05pm timeslot at the Sutro Stage -- Nile Rodgers and his funk-disco band Chic will instead perform on Friday evening, right before Paul McCartney takes the stage at Lands End.
